楼主: carweed
1725 2

[数据管理求助] @@@请教另类Reshape的方法:非结构化数据如何结构化?谢谢! [推广有奖]

  • 1关注
  • 6粉丝

已卖:8份资源

教授

94%

还不是VIP/贵宾

-

威望
0
论坛币
86 个
通用积分
86.8961
学术水平
9 点
热心指数
8 点
信用等级
6 点
经验
120679 点
帖子
1010
精华
0
在线时间
2338 小时
注册时间
2009-1-19
最后登录
2025-11-20

楼主
carweed 发表于 2014-8-13 18:18:04 |AI写论文

+2 论坛币
k人 参与回答

经管之家送您一份

应届毕业生专属福利!

求职就业群
赵安豆老师微信:zhaoandou666

经管之家联合CDA

送您一个全额奖学金名额~ !

感谢您参与论坛问题回答

经管之家送您两个论坛币!

+2 论坛币
    问题:如何实现如图所示的数据转换?希望由左边的数据结构转换成右边的。谢谢!
     year一列,一行可能有好几个值,也可能只有一个值。每个year的同一行中,不同的值用“,”分隔。
     不知道这样的Reshape如何实现?谢谢大家!

1.JPG


二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

关键词:reshape 结构化数据 Shape 结构化 RES 如图所示 另类 如何

沙发
vinkchen 发表于 2014-8-13 20:00:05
split year, gen(nme) parse(",")
reshape long nme, i(part)
drop if nme==""
drop _j year

藤椅
carweed 发表于 2014-8-13 21:41:28
vinkchen 发表于 2014-8-13 20:00
split year, gen(nme) parse(",")
reshape long nme, i(part)
drop if nme==""
赞!谢谢!

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注jltj
拉您入交流群
GMT+8, 2025-12-9 11:37